Magnetical Drawing



My theme was this month magnetical drawing. I had bought some of those drawing boards for children, which can wipe out every drawing anew. The drawing possibilities are not very good, but the theme seemed interesting to me.
I made some simple forms, playing with the hexagons, triangles and a cricle. You can see how the powder is shifted to one side, so we are not able to "fill" a black shape. If you stay on the geometry of the hexagon, it is acceptable, but....

The drawing board is called magnetic because it uses a magnet to draw on iron (?) powder caught in between the cells of a wire of hexagones. The fact that the wiring is not on suares is really amazing!
(There is a clean state, where does the powder come from when drawing?)
